What Is a Constant Voltage LED Driver?

定電圧 LED driver is a power supply designed to provide a stable voltage output regardless of the load current. Typically, these drivers output a voltage of 12V or 24V, making them ideal for powering LED strips, modules, and various lighting fixtures. Unlike constant current drivers, which adjust their output based on the LED’s load, constant voltage drivers maintain a consistent voltage level, allowing for flexibility in connecting multiple LED lights in parallel.

  • Determine the LED Voltage Requirement
  • Before selecting a constant voltage LED driver, it’s essential to know the voltage requirement of your LEDs. Most LED strips operate on either 12V or 24V, so you will need to choose a driver that matches this requirement.

  • Calculate Total Power Consumption
  • Next, you need to calculate the total power consumption of your LED system. This involves adding up the wattage of each connected LED. Make sure to choose a driver with a wattage rating that exceeds the total wattage of your LEDs to ensure reliable performance and avoid overheating.

  • Check for Safety Certifications
  • Ensure that the LED driver you choose has necessary safety certifications, such as CE, UL, or RoHS. These certifications guarantee that the product meets safety standards and regulations, minimizing the risk of electrical hazards.

    Common Parameters of Constant Voltage LED Drivers

    When selecting a constant voltage LED driver, it’s important to consider several parameters, including:

  • Input Voltage Range: Ensure the driver’s input voltage matches the power supply available at your installation site.
  • 出力電圧: As previously noted, confirm that the output voltage aligns with the LED specifications (12V or 24V).
  • Rated Power: The driver’s wattage rating should exceed the total consumption of your LEDs.
  • 効率性: Higher efficiency ratings typically mean better energy savings and less heat generation.
